Key learning outcomes During the study, students will first learn the basics of major biological disciplines (botany and zoology, basics of ecology, genetics). In addition, the field includes several issues. The protection of nature itself is crucial, especially at the species level. It is closely related to the breeding of pets and the cultivation of collection plants (whether in zoological or botanical gardens or hobby or commercial breeding) and international trade in them. Here we pay particular attention to the issue of the Convention on International Trade in Endangered Species of Wild Fauna and Flora, known by the acronym CITES. An integral part of the study are subjects that increase the overall qualification of students and bring them generally useful skills, such as the ability to understand professional text, ability to search and critically evaluate information, knowledge of successful presentation of not only professional information, group cooperation, communication, etc. emphasis is placed on the language skills of graduates.

Occupational profiles of graduates with examples Graduates will be able to hold positions where a broader and deeper knowledge of internationally protected organisms is necessary (botanical and zoological gardens, institutions dealing with nature conservation, the sphere of enlightenment, education, etc.). Therefore, graduates will find employment mainly as specialists in state institutions (Ministry of Agriculture, Ministry of the Environment, Czech Environmental Inspectorate, environmental departments of regional authorities and municipalities, police departments monitoring illegal trade in organisms, customs administration, etc.), or also in similarly focused EU institutions. They will find further application in the scientific research sphere, as well as in the field of education, including the media, where highly professionally funded workers are increasingly needed. Furthermore, as operators or managers of companies engaged in the breeding of "hobby" animals and the cultivation of collection plants and trade in these organisms.
